  1. Turn off the power
  2. Pull out on the yellow disk and gently rotate it to set the time
  3. Loosen the nut on the start and stop triggers. They should be marked on and off.
  4. Slide each trigger around the disk to the time desired for on and off.
  5. Tighten the nut on each trigger
  6. Turn on the power.
